Another controversy over altruistic seats emerged at a high-speed rail station on June 23, 2024, as captured by a citizen on June 22. A woman placed her belongings on an altruistic seat inside the station, and when advised by others, she retorted, 'Which article in the Constitution of the Republic of China prohibits putting things on the altruistic seat?' leaving onlookers baffled. During peak hours, the woman occupied two seats, leading to a dispute when others requested her to free up the space. The high-speed rail emphasized that altruistic seats are meant for needy passengers and not for holding personal items, pledging to intervene if such incidents occur in the future.
